JavaEE 快速開發框架 Wabacus 3.5 版已發布

jopen 12年前發布 | 7K 次閱讀 Wabacus

JavaEE 快速開發框架 Wabacus 3.5 版已發布,通過該框架,開發者的代碼量可以減少60%以上,開發效率提高5倍以上。

Wabacus 3.5 發布,開發效率提高5倍以上

3.5版本主要功能變更列表:

  • 輸入框改進,包括:
  •           1) 標簽支持description屬性,用于配置顯示在輸入框后面的描述信息
              2) 的styleproperty屬性支持[overwrite]style和(overwrite)style兩種格式,分別表示兩種覆蓋系統內置的樣式字符串的方式
              3) checkbox/radiobox兩種輸入框支持inlinecount屬性,可以指定每行顯示的選項個數,超過將自動分行顯示
              4) 支持復選下拉框
              5) 下拉框依賴時不光可以依賴下拉框,還可以依賴任意類型的輸入框,一個輸入框可以被多個下拉框依賴,一個下拉框也可以依賴多個輸入框。

  • 支持表單數據自動填充功能,即在一個表單輸入框中輸入數據后,其它輸入框可以從數據庫中取相應數據進行自動填充
  • 文件上傳輸入框和文件上傳標簽支持攔截器,可以在其中控制文件上傳以及取到被上傳文件的信息,還可以控制文件上傳界面的顯示。
  • 標簽支持beforesearch屬性,用于指定查詢數據前置動作,開發人員可以在此控制查詢條件值以或中止查詢操作
  • 表格樹的inistate屬性廢除,新增treexpandlayer屬性,用于指定第一次訪問時,自動展開的層數,從0開始,如果配置為-1,則展開所有層
  • 標簽支持confirmessage屬性,用于指定刪除報表數據時確認提示信息,可以在其中指定動態提示值,比如提示信息中包含某列的值。
  • 在wabacus.cfg.xml的中注冊報表配置文件和資源文件時,支持正則表達式模式匹配,不需逐個配置文件注冊。
  • 支持Postgresql數據庫,dbtype類為com.wabacus.config.database.type.Postgresql(由水晶峰朋友貢獻)
  • 所有彈出窗口(包括彈出窗口輸入框、文件上傳輸入框、editablelist報表類型的彈出編輯框等等)都支持彈出界面大小的靈活控制,比如指定顯示大小、是否初始為最大化或最小化顯示、是否顯示“最大化”、“最小化”窗口的按鈕等等。
  • 一些其它細節上的改進與優化,比如:優化了列過濾的顯示效果、在服務器端提供了頁面跳轉的接口方法、解決了報表在IE6瀏覽器中有時候顯示效果不好看的問題等等。
  • 修正了一些用戶使用過程中發現的BUG。
  • </inputbox></inputbox></ul>

    下載地址:wabacus3.5-release.zip

    來自: http://www.iteye.com/news/26201

     本文由用戶 jopen 自行上傳分享,僅供網友學習交流。所有權歸原作者,若您的權利被侵害,請聯系管理員。
     轉載本站原創文章,請注明出處,并保留原始鏈接、圖片水印。
     本站是一個以用戶分享為主的開源技術平臺,歡迎各類分享!